Annoyingly classic
I'd not played or even seen Sam & Max as a kid, so nostalgia's not too strong on this one. It's a fun, funny and inventive point-and-click with wacky puzzles and great dialogue/voice acting. However technically, it holds itself back. The wacky puzzles are, uh, nearly impossible to think up, even if it's not hard to get two thirds of the solution. A puzzle where you need Max to take something involves a dialogue option that doesn't fit on the screen, a circumstance when you light up a cave seems like everything you light up should be interactive, you need multiple looks-like-background items to complete the game, there are often times when no one has any useful advice for you and getting to the game's last screen is actually such a messy clickfest that I didn't even know it existed. So it's a flawed classic. It's beloved for good reason, but it's definitely got these shortcomings.
